The Kerala Plus One Christmas Second Term Maths exam is expected to follow a structured marking scheme, which will help students understand the weightage of each question type. The expected Kerala Plus One Christmas Second Term Maths exam pattern for 2025–26 is given below to help students understand the marks distribution and question types clearly.
Question Type | Number of Questions | Marks |
Very Short Answer (1 mark) | 4–6 | 4–6 |
Short Answer (2 marks) | 6–8 | 12–16 |
Short Answer Type II (3 marks) | 5–7 | 15–21 |
Long Answer (4 marks) | 3–5 | 12–20 |
Total Marks | — | 60 Marks |
Students must revise all important formulas daily to ensure that they remember them during the Kerala Plus One Christmas Second Term Maths exam.
Students must practice textbook problems properly, as many questions are asked directly from the NCERT exercises.
Students must solve previous Christmas Second Term papers to understand the question pattern and difficulty level.
They must focus more on high-weightage chapters like Trigonometry, Limits, Derivatives, and Probability, which will help them score good marks.

To pass the DHSE Kerala Plus One exam , you need to score a minimum of 30% in each subject and an overall aggregate of 30%.
Yes, you can sit for the Kerala DHSE exam if your attendance percentage is more than 75%. As per the Kerala board , students need to have at least 75% attendance in each subject to be eligible to sit for the exam.
Yes, if you're appearing for the Kerala DHSE exam , you must fulfil some Kerala DHSE 2nd year exam requirements, such as:
You must score D+ or above age in all subjects in the Kerala DHSE 1st year examination result .
Continuous evaluation (CE): Students must undergo continuous evaluation for each subject, such that must submit the assignments and projects on time.
If you're a regular student, you will be required to complete at least 75% of the total number of working days on the last day of the academic year.
You can check your Kerala DHSE exam results on the official results portal of the Directorate of Higher Secondary Education (DHSE), Kerala, at www.keralaresults.nic.in. Enter your roll number and date of birth in the given fields to view your result. Ensure you have your admit card handy for accurate details.
